Cost of Concrete Sidewalk Lifting in Springfield

Concrete sidewalk lifting is a practical solution for homeowners and businesses in Springfield, MO, looking to address uneven or sunken walkways. This method, often more affordable than complete replacement, involves raising the existing concrete to its original level. Understanding the cost of concrete sidewalk lifting can help you budget effectively for this essential maintenance task.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Size of the Area: Larger areas typically require more material and labor, increasing the overall cost.
  • Severity of Damage: More extensive damage may necessitate additional lifting or stabilization efforts, impacting the price.
  •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may require specialized equipment or additional labor, adding to the expense.
  • Material Used: The type of lifting material, such as polyurethane foam or traditional mudjacking, can influence the cost.
  •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Springfield, MO, can vary, affecting the total cost of the project.
  • Additional Repairs: Any necessary repairs to adjacent structures or landscaping can add to the overall expense.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ost Range
Basic Sidewalk Lifting (per sq. ft.) $5 - $8
Extensive Lifting (per sq. ft.) $8 - $12
Polyurethane Foam Injection (per sq. ft.) $10 - $15
Mudjacking (per sq. ft.) $5 - $9
Crack Filling and Sealing $2 - $4 per linear foot
Additional Repairs Varies based on scope
